A Heavy Rainstorm has killed 3 persons in three villages of Birnin kudu local government area of Jigawa state, the council chairman Alhaji Wada Faka said.
The chairman said the flood has destroyed many houses and washed away farm produce worth millions of Naira.
Faka said apart from the destruction of houses, properties, and food items were also destroyed by the flood as he sought the federal and state government intervention urgently to save the lives of the affected persons.
The chairman said the people need urgent support with food items, medications, and sleeping materials to avoid any occurrence of an outbreak.
Malamawa Gangare, a village with over 150 houses has been destroyed; however, the residents expressed gratitude to Allah for no death arising from the incidence.
A resident of the area Ali Muhammad said the area has never experienced such disaster since August 2007 when a similar flood swept away houses and farmlands.
He said this year’s flooding is the worst ever in the entire area.
The chairman of Birnin Kudu council area Alhaji Wada Faka said that the council is assessing the disaster caused by the flood while assuring that all necessary support would be made to the victims.
